Boxing day is now a public holiday as was the case before Bingu wa Mutharika

Government has ordered the reinstatement of Boxing Day as a public holiday effective this year.

A statement signed by local government spokesperson Maganizo Mazeze, indicates that the holiday has been restored because most Christians still observe as an important day.

“Government has observed that many Malawians Christians continue to treat boxing day as a special day in their religious calendar and that it is also celebrated as a public holiday in many countries and societies the world-over,” reads part of the statement.

Boxing Day, which falls on December 26, was removed by the Mutharika regime on the basis that the country had too many public holidays which were counter productive
